Transaction d870ff07af7782e0d6d9781e23ab0f073eca8d3599871ee27d8bbb799032fa8e

17 Input
2 Outputs
  • d870ff07af7782e0d6d9781e23ab0f073eca8d3599871ee27d8bbb799032fa8e:0
  • value  10023220
    address  1GYpdA6wYDQuBt4DGHSGwLoWGNaD8EaNcv
  • d870ff07af7782e0d6d9781e23ab0f073eca8d3599871ee27d8bbb799032fa8e:1
  • value  5587
    address  33VDmSarhMFATMX7pVLdVRpKFMw6WHk1KZ